NEB’s restriction enzyme buffer system makes your restriction digests easy and convenient. We are able to offer >210 restriction enzymes that cut in a single buffer, CutSmart® . This improves ease-of-use, especially when performing double digests. In addition to indicating the performance of each enzyme in the 4 NEBuffers, the chart also indicates ligation and recutting, star activity, and whether or not more than 1-site is required for cleavage.

Ligation and Recutting Notes
The following notes appear with any enzymes having ligation efficiencies lower than 100% as assessed by ligation and recutting.
a. Ligation is less than 10%.
b. Ligation is 25% -75%.
c. Recutting after ligation is less than 5%.
d. Recutting after ligation is 50% -75%.
e. Ligation and recutting after ligation is not applicable since the enzyme is either a nicking enzyme, is affected by methylation, or if the enzyme cleaves outside its recognition sequence.
Star Activity Notes
The following notes appear with any enzymes when star activity is a concern.
1. Star Activity may result from extended digestion, high enzyme concentration or a glycerol concentration of > 5%.
2. Star Activity may result from extended digestion.
3. Star Activity may result from a glycerol concentration of > 5%.
*. May exhibit star activity in this buffer.
